A 91-year-old grandpa in Kaohsiung has made his corrugated tin roof into a “sky garden” with all kinds of vegetables. But due to its steep slope, the sight of the elderly man tending to his precarious garden every day leaves his neighbors in a cold sweat.
The third-floor roof of this building has a tiny vegetable garden, tended by this elderly man in a conical hat. He waters the plants without a care in the world, even as his neighbors notice the dangerously steep grade of the roof.

What if a pot or a tree or one of those pipes falls and hits someone? But what’s really concerning is the man up there watering the plants. It’s really dangerous!
The neighbors are worried the man could slip or the roof could give way. Reporters went to find the man in question. At 91 years old, Mr. Liu was more than happy to give a tour of his beloved garden.

I walk over here and there’s always something to hold onto. I can grab on there, or over there. It’s very safe. I’m not afraid of falling.
All kinds of plants are growing on Mr. Liu’s rooftop garden, including bitter melon, leafy greens, and even a terrace for loofah, all built by his own hands. He confidently pointed out the handrails he installed everywhere, saying he’s not afraid of falling, and there’s also a railing along the edge. He said he goes up there twice a day.

It’s hot in the afternoon, so I go up in the morning and evening. My legs are still in great shape.

It’s not dangerous for him to grow vegetables up there. He’s been doing it for years, and there’s a fence to block him from falling.
It’s a sight to behold, seeing this elderly gardener defy gravity and his age by climbing around on the roof. But even if he’s confident he won’t fall, the neighbors are still worried for his safety.
